古旧 (gǔ jiù) — antiquated, archaic
Definition
Refers to objects (furniture, books, buildings) that are old and showing their age — emphasizes physical wear and outdated appearance, not just age itself. Compare with 古老, which describes living things or ongoing things that are long-established.
adjective

Examples
- 古旧。Zhè xiē gǔ jiù de jiā jù yǐ jīng yǒu shàng bǎi nián de lì shǐ le.These antiquated pieces of furniture have a history of hundreds of years.
- 古旧。Nà zuò gǔ jiù de sì miào xī yǐn le hěn duō yóu kè.That archaic temple attracted many tourists.
- 古旧,。Tā jiā bǎo cún zhe yì běn gǔ jiù de shū, fēng miàn yǐ jīng biàn huáng le.His family keeps an antiquated book, whose cover has turned yellow.
